n, m = map(int, input().split()) na, nb = 0, 0 ma, mb = 0, 0 s = input() t = input() for i in range(len(s)): if s[i] == "A": na += 1 else: nb += 1 for i in range(len(t)): if t[i] == "A": ma += 1 else: mb += 1 print(min(na, ma) + min(nb, mb))